Mars in Sagittarius Overview

PDF download Download Article
  1. In astrology, the planet Mars rules action and aggression. Therefore, your Mars sign placement influences your energy, primal instincts, and the way you assert yourself. If you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ement, you’re an action-oriented person through and through—nothing can stop you from exploring, learning, and discovering everything the world has to offer! [1]
    • Sagittarius is a fire sign ruled by Jupiter, the planet of abundance and expansion.
    • Thus, if you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ement, you aggressively pursue your desire to collect knowledge and experience new things.

Mars in Sagittarius Personality Traits

PDF download Download Article
  1. With Mars in Sagittarius on your star chart, you’re naturally restless and yearn to explore! It’s impossible to pin you down because you’re always on the move, whether you’re trying a new hobby (for the thousandth time) or jetting off on a last-minute road trip to satisfy your wanderlust. You can’t stand being idle; you live for exciting adventures and are most satisfied when you’re busy doing something. [2]
    • Sagittarius’ ruling planet, Jupiter (the planet of expansion), is the source of your endlessly adventurous spirit when you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ement.
    • With a Mars in Sagittarius placement, your adventurousness also gives you a strong sense of autonomy and independence. You’re never afraid to do your own thing!
  2. As a Mars in Sagittarius, you always look on the bright side of life. You recognize that the world is full of endless possibilities, and you’re open to exploring every last one of them! You’re likely a breath of fresh air for your friends and family, who can always count on you to liven up the mood and cheer them up on bad days. [3]
    • With a Mars in Sagittarius placement, you likely also have a killer sense of humor! You know how to make anyone laugh, and you’re always ready with a joke or funny quip.
    • However, that doesn’t mean you never get upset. If you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ement, you likely have a fiery temper to match—and the best way for you to blow off steam is to do some sort of physical activity or exercise.
  3. You’re practically overflowing with energy and enthusiasm if you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ement! You likely have several projects in progress at any given time because you have so many ideas (and the boundless energy to explore them all). However, you may sometimes throw out half-finished projects when a new idea hits you; as a Mars in Sagittarius, you may be a bit impatient. [4]
  4. Knowledge is power when you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ement. You’re curious and determined to absorb every scrap of information you come across! You’re always working to expand your knowledge of the world around you, extremely open-minded, and eager to explore all perspectives. In your mind, closed-minded thinking limits your ability to learn new things.
    • Sagittarius is a mutable sign; mutable signs are known for being flexible, adaptable, and comfortable with change.
    • Thus, when you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ement, your open-mindedness and flexibility often come from Sagittarius’ mutable modality.
    • Your curiosity and desire to explore new perspectives also means you love a friendly debate! You love philosophizing and explaining your thought processes—though you may take it personally when others don’t agree with you.
  5. When you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ement, truth and honesty are incredibly important to you. You won’t stand for any dishonesty from friends or partners, and you’re always unafraid to say exactly what’s on your mind. You’ve got a reputation for integrity and straightforwardness—though you may also be blunt and a bit insensitive at times. When you say exactly what you’re thinking, you may not think it through beforehand!
    • If you have Mars in Sagittarius on your chart, try considering your words before saying them and being a little more sensitive to everyone else’s feelings.
    • However, if your Mercury placement (which influences your communication style) is more tactful, you may naturally be less blunt than the average Mars in Sagittarius.
      • For example, Cancer and Pisces are both insightful and sensitive signs, so having a Mercury in Cancer or Pisces placement may temper the blunt honesty of Mars in Sagittarius.

Love & Sex for Mars in Sagittarius

PDF download Download Article
  1. If you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ement, you have a very lighthearted approach to relationships. You rarely look for a commitment right away; rather, you look for someone who’s fun to hang out with. You also prefer partners who aren’t too uptight or serious since you get along best with people who share your carefree approach to life. [5]
    • Venus is the planet of love in astrology—so, with a Mars in Sagittarius placement, you may be most attracted to people with their Venus placement in one of the fire or air signs.
    • The fire signs are Leo , Aries —and, of course, Sagittarius. Someone with a Leo, Aries, or Sagittarius in Venus placement is likely to share your boldness, enthusiasm, and passion for life!
    • The air signs are Gemini , Aquarius , and Libra. People with Gemini, Aquarius, or Libra in Venus placements tend to be independent, inquisitive, and easygoing—perfect for Mars in Sagittarius.
  2. With a Mars in Sagittarius placement, you’re very passionate and enthusiastic, and you have a playful approach to intimacy. Sex isn’t something you do to connect emotionally with a partner, but rather a way to have fun together—and in the bedroom, with your open-mindedness and sense of adventure, you’re up to try anything and everything.
  3. If you have a Mars in Sagittarius placement, you’re perfectly capable of committing to someone (if that’s what you want), but it may take you a while to settle down. You’re far more interested in keeping things simple and taking your relationships one day at a time—and you’re likely looking for a partner who won’t try to box you in or stifle your independence. [6]
    • When you feel bored, your instinct is to get outside and go on an adventure! That’s why an equally lively, energetic partner who can keep up with your flights of fancy may be able to capture your heart.

Mars in Sagittarius Transit

PDF download Download Article
  1. You’re more likely to explore new, unexpected possibilities when Mars passes through adventurous Sagittarius on its journey around the Sun. You may also find yourself feeling a little more optimistic—which may spur you to take bigger risks and approach challenges with a can-do attitude. You may focus less on the present and more on the future—and whatever big thing you’ll do next.
    • Be careful not to overextend yourself when Mars transits Sagittarius. It’s okay to be a little impulsive and take a risk once in a while, but remember to do so in moderation.
    • You may also feel a surge of wanderlust when Mars is in Sagittarius! It’s the perfect time to plan a trip —or take a spur-of-the-moment day trip when the mood strikes.
    • Consider picking up a new skill or hobby when Mars transits Sagittarius. You may find yourself in the mood to expand your horizons, and you can do it by signing up for a class or reading a skill book in your free time.
